Royal Society for India, Pakistan and Ceylon Collections: lantern slides of architectural subjects in Calcutta, Hyderabad and Mysore
Scope & Content:
Collection of 69 lantern slides, originally housed in a cardboard drawer box, inscribed on side T. H. S. Biddulph, 7 Nicholas Lane, E.C., and with label pasted on side reading Calcutta Seringapatam Mysore Nandidroog. The collection has now been rehoused The subject matter comprises photographs ...
